+2011-04-06 14:11 Fergus Henderson <opensource@google.com>
+
+ * test/testdistcc.py:
+
+ Fix some issues that caused the gdb-related tests to fail:
+
+ 1. Recent gcc versions want us to use -Wl,--build-id
+ rather than --build-id.
+
+ 2. We had missed one of the places where we need to be passing
+ that flag in.
+
+ 3. With recent gcc/gdb versions, "break main; run"
+ will sometimes stop at the first statement inside of main
+ rather than on the function declaration.
+ So "break main; run; step" may end up inside the code to
+ puts() rather than in the code for main().
+ My fix was to use "break main; run; next" instead.
+ It is inderminate (varies based on whether you use "-O", for example)
+ whether we end up at the call to puts() or after the call to puts(),
+ but either way the call to puts() should be in the gdb output log.
+
+ Reviewed by Craig Silverstein.

+2009-02-17 23:10 Fergus Henderson <opensource@google.com>
+
+ * src/dotd.c, src/emaillog.c, src/include_server_if.c, src/lsdistcc.c,
+ src/rslave.c, src/stringmap.c, src/timeval.c:
+
+ Ensure that all ".c" files start with "#include <config.h>".
+
+ This will hopefully fix issue 39
+ <http://code.google.com/p/distcc/issues/detail?id=39>.
+ Some header files were using #if statements that depended on macros
+ defined in config.h
+ without #including config.h first. The result was a compilation error,
+ because
+ "#if !HAVE_DECL_SNPRINTF" was evaluating to true because config.h
+ hadn't been included,
+ causing us to declare snprintf() when we shouldn't, leading to a
+ conflict with the
+ declaration in the standard header files.
+
+ (The alternative solution would have been to add "#include <config.h>"
+ to every header file that uses '#if'. I decided not to do that, just
+ for consistency with the existing code.)
+
+2009-02-17 23:10 Fergus Henderson <opensource@google.com>
+
+ * packaging/rpm.sh:
+
+ Fix a non-portability in rpm.sh:
+ use "trap ... HUP" rather than "trap ... SIGHUP".
+
+ The Posix.1 standard
+ <http://www.opengroup.org/onlinepubs/9699919799/utilities/V3_chap02.html#trap>
+ says:
+ The condition can be EXIT, 0 (equivalent to EXIT), or a signal
+ specified
+ using a symbolic name, without the SIG prefix, as listed in the tables
+ of signal names in the <signal.h> header [...]; for example, HUP, INT,
+ QUIT, TERM. Implementations may permit names with the SIG prefix or
+ ignore case in signal names as an extension.
+
+ Previously, the code was relying on this optional extension.

+2009-01-30 17:27 Fergus Henderson <opensource@google.com>
+
+ * include_server/macro_eval.py, include_server/parse_file.py,
+ test/testdistcc.py:
+
+ Fix issue 35 <http://code.google.com/p/distcc/issues/detail?id=35>.
+ This was a bug where the include server was crashing in certain cases
+ (when the argument to a macro ended in a backslash) due to an escaping
+ problem in the use of Python's re.sub() function. The fix was to
+ replace all occurrences of backslash in the replacement string
+ with double-backslash, which re.sub() will then translate back to
+ a single backslash. (I also changed the code to not bother using
+ re.compile() since we only use the regexp once.)
+
+ Also, fix a bug where we were not allowing backslashes in filenames.
+
+ I added regression tests for both of these bugs
+ (and I verified that they were true regression tests).
+
+ Reviewed by Craig Silverstein.
+
+2009-01-26 23:50 Fergus Henderson <opensource@google.com>
+
+ * pump.in:
+
+ Handle failure of "mktemp" more gracefully in the pump script.
+ It was printing an error message, but then it would continue
+ on even if mktemp had failed (it called "exit 1", but only
+ in a subshell). It would then go on and try to start the
+ include server, which would end up hanging.
+ The fix is to make sure that we call "exit 1" from the main
+ shell whenever MakeTmpFile fails.
+
+ Reviewed by Craig Silverstein.

+2008-12-22 22:21 Fergus Henderson <opensource@google.com>
+
+ * include_server/compiler_defaults.py:
+
+ Fix a bug where the SystemIncludeDirectories_Case test
+ was failing on systems where /tmp was a symlink.
+ This failure indicated a real bug: on such systems,
+ distcc was not correctly handling -I<dir> where
+ <dir> is a subdirectory of a system include directory,
+ e.g. -I/usr/include/foo.
+
+ The code was calling _RealPrefix(client_root + system_dir)
+ but was implicitly assuming that the answer would always
+ start with client_root. That is, it was implicitly assuming
+ that client_root did not contain any symlinks.
+
+ I changed the code to use
+ _RealPrefixWithinClientRoot(client_root, system_dir)
+ so that it would find the appropriate prefix of system_dir
+ rather than looking at the prefixes of client_root.

+distcc-3.2 "Back in black" 2011-10-11
+
+ FEATURES:
+
+ * IPv6 support (adshea, Benjamin R. Haskell, Bob Ham).
+
+ * Optional support for GSS-API authentication (Ian Baker at CERN)
+
+ * Added an environment variable DISTCC_SKIP_LOCAL_RETRY for skipping
+ the local retry in case of a remote compilation failure (Ryan Burns).
+
+ * Some constants that were previously hard-coded in the
+ sources are now configurable via environment variables:
+ DISTCC_MAX_DISCREPANCY, DISTCC_IO_TIMEOUT (Lei Zhang).
+
+ BUG FIXES:
+
+ * Fixed the following 20 issues <http://code.google.com/p/distcc/issues/list>:
+
+ 30: 3.0 on OSX: ValueError: Expected absolute path, but got '(framework'.
+ 33: distcc --scan-includes dumps core
+ 34: Zeroconf fails if avahi supports IPv6
+ 35: Include server internal error: '<class 'sre_constants.error'>: ('bogus escape (end of line)',)'
+ 36: distcc-mon-gnome displays multiple rows for same host/slot
+ 39: build with gcc 4.1 snprintf.h error "expected declaration specifiers"
+ 42: distcc --show-hosts fails when using Avahi with IPv6 support and +zeroconf for distcc.
+ 43: Remove duplicate hosts from zeroconf list
+ 44: Failed tests on make check (gentoo gcc-4.3.3)
+ 46: Add TAGS target to Makefile.in
+ 49: make check fails on PreprocessAsm_Case
+ 57: Fix warnings
+ 58: PUMP mode can`t PARSE the HOSTS
+ 60: CPlusPlus test case fails with GCC 4.4.1
+ 61: Gdb tests fail in pumped mode on Ubuntu 9.10 amd64
+ 66: pump mode fails to compile certain KDE-4 packages, finds/looks for incorrect headers
+ 70: variable overlapping causing errors..
+ 75: include_server documentation, distcc_fallback flag incorrect
+ 81: distcc 3.1 will not compile correctly with current version of gcc
